You want to schedule three follow-up reminders:
• One for tomorrow,
• One for five business days later,
• One exactly two weeks later.
You are allowed to call tools in parallel, as they run in the cloud. What tool calls will you make?
Expected output
First: Call **calendar.get_current_date** → {"action": "get_current_date"} and persist result as "today".

In Parallel:
• **calendar.add_business_days** → {"action": "add_business_days", "start_date": "today", "days_to_add": 1}
• **calendar.add_business_days** → {"action": "add_business_days", "start_date": "today", "days_to_add": 5}
• **calendar.add_business_days** → {"action": "add_business_days", "start_date": "today", "days_to_add": 14}

Next: For each result, persist separately using **memory.store_item** with keys like "date_plus_1", "date_plus_5", "date_plus_14".

Then: For each stored date, call **calendar.schedule_reminder** with {"action": "schedule_reminder", "date": "<calculated_date>", "reminder_text": "Follow-up"}.

Finally: Persist each reminder result separately using **memory.store_item** with keys like "reminder_tomorrow", "reminder_5bdays", "reminder_2wks".
